[QUOTE="BSWIFT, post: 1440949, member: 16802"] Basing my opinion from my experience on the KX, the Mobetta porting makes the power come on sooner and smoother. Having FM tell me there was a broken tab on one of the power valve springs kind of explains the twitchy feel I was experiencing. The YZ has always had awesome low end with a massive hit in the mid range, hoping the smoothing of the mid range hit will tame the wicked beast. I had approximately 150 hours on the original top end and I had used the Jetting Guide from DRN to set up the YZ.
